Local tips
- Visit during sunset for stunning panoramic views of Bath bathed in golden light.
- Wear comfortable shoes as the trails can be uneven and hilly.
- Pack a picnic to enjoy at one of the many scenic spots throughout the park.
- Check the weather forecast before your visit, as trails can become muddy after rain.
- Bring binoculars for birdwatching and to appreciate the diverse flora and fauna.

Public Transport
From Bath city center, you can take a bus to the Claverton Down area. Head to the nearest bus stop at Southgate, which is conveniently located near the main shopping area. Look for bus numbers 5 or 18 that go towards Claverton Down. Get off at the stop named 'Claverton Down'. From there, follow the signs for Bath Skyline, which will guide you along the footpaths leading to the start of the Skyline walk. It's about a 10-15 minute walk from the bus stop to the main trailhead.
